Steel anchor beam mounting method
The invention provides a steel anchor beam mounting method. The steel anchor beam mounting method comprises the following steps that a pre-positioning structure of a steel anchor beam is mounted on aconcrete support in a tower column; a first construction platform is erected between the two horizontally-opposite concrete corbels; hoisting the split steel anchor beam on the first construction platform; erecting a second construction platform above the first construction platform; splicing the steel anchor beams on the first construction platform by utilizing the second construction platform; the spliced steel anchor beams are placed on the corresponding concrete supports through a second construction platform; from bottom to top, the steel anchor beams on the upper layer are used for conducting elevation positioning on the steel anchor beams on the lower layer; the steel anchor beams subjected to elevation positioning are aligned and installed in the tower column, so that installationof the single steel anchor beam is completed; and the steps are executed circularly until all the steel anchor beams are installed. According to the construction method, the split steel anchor beams are separately hoisted on the first construction platform, so that the construction efficiency of the tower column can be improved.
